Research interests

My main research interests are trauma and trauma-therapy, as well as veterans' experiences. I am also interested in highlighting and amplifying marginalised voices within this research.

Postgraduate supervision

I am currently supervising the following ClinPsyD research projects:

The Windrush Generation: Intergenerational Trauma and Gender Experiences (Sian Morrison)

Female Veterans: Experiences during Military Service and Reintegration into Civilian Life (Maddy Morrison)

The Role of Beliefs in Trauma-Therapy (Lekkie Howell) - co-supervising with Tim Alexander
